Anthropic launches new Claude 4 AI models

Anthropic has announced the release of two new AI models, Claude Opus 4 and Claude Sonnet 4, designed to enhance coding, reasoning, and AI agent performance.

The models aim to improve tasks that require extended reasoning and tool usage.

According to the company, these models feature improved memory capabilities and enhanced instruction-following.

Both models are accessible through the Anthropic API, Amazon Bedrock, and Google Cloud’s Vertex AI.

Pricing remains consistent with previous models, with Opus 4 priced at US$15/US$75 per million tokens and Sonnet 4 at US$3/US$15.

1️⃣ AI coding models are evolving beyond assistants to become collaborative partners

The shift in language from “AI coding assistants” to models that can sustain “long-running tasks” and “work continuously for several hours” reflects a fundamental evolution in how AI participates in development workflows.

According to Stanford’s 2025 AI Index Report, AI has moved from simple code completion to executing complex development tasks autonomously, transforming how software is created 1.

This progression mirrors broader industry trends, with predictions that 70% of new applications will be developed with AI assistance by 2025, as developers transition from code producers to strategic architects who leverage AI capabilities 2.

Multiple partners cited in the announcement—including Cursor, Replit, and Block—specifically highlight Claude Opus 4’s ability to understand complex codebases and maintain performance over extended periods, suggesting a shift toward true collaborative intelligence rather than just supplementary assistance.

The introduction of “extended thinking with tool use” represents a significant advancement where Claude can alternate between reasoning and accessing external resources, reflecting how human developers work through challenging problems.

2️⃣ Standardized benchmarks have become crucial differentiators in the AI coding race

Anthropic’s emphasis on Claude Opus 4’s performance on SWE-bench (72.5%) and Terminal-bench (43.2%) reflects the growing importance of standardized metrics in evaluating AI coding capabilities.

The AI coding landscape has become increasingly competitive, with multiple comprehensive comparisons published in 2025 evaluating between 10-15 different models on specific coding tasks and benchmarks 3 4.
